AECOM Tishman is seeking a Proposal Specialist/Marketing Content Writer to be based in New York, NY. 

This position is expected to begin immediately.  

The Proposal Specialist/Marketing Content Writer: 

  • Foremost, writes and edits content for client proposals.  
  • Creates outlines and content plans for proposals, and provides recommendations to project teams on section structure and relevant content. May serve as lead writer and editor for tailored resumes, project description sections, executive summaries, and/or project approaches for proposals. 
  • Leads and facilitates structured reviews of proposals by the project team. Manages the implementation of proposal revisions based on direction from review teams. 
  • Supports client presentation preparation in conjunction with the project team, including developing slide decks, prepping the team, and attending pitches as needed. 
  • Performs a variety of copyediting and other writing-related tasks for marketing materials as needed. 
  • Collaborates with other marketing department teammates to handle a dynamic workload.  
  • Is comfortable working in a fast-paced, deadline-driven environment with multiple partners and stakeholders, including executives.  
  • Completes internal debriefs for proposals, drawing on past pursuit debrief information. Supports team during win/loss debriefs and gathering of client feedback on proposals to ensure continuous improvement. 
  • Takes initiative to keep marketing collateral up to date as time allows. 
  • Performs a self-check of work prior to submitting to others for review/approval.

What you need to know about the NYC Tech Scene

As the undisputed financial capital of the world, New York City is an epicenter of startup funding activity. The city has a thriving fintech scene and is a major player in verticals ranging from AI to biotech, cybersecurity and digital media. It also has universities like NYU, Columbia and Cornell Tech attracting students and researchers from across the globe, providing the ecosystem with a constant influx of world-class talent. And its East Coast location and three international airports make it a perfect spot for European companies establishing a foothold in the United States.

Key Facts About NYC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 549,200; 6%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Capgemini, Bloomberg, IBM, Spotify
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, Fintech
  • Funding Landscape: $25.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Greycroft, Thrive Capital, Union Square Ventures, FirstMark Capital, Tiger Global Management, Tribeca Venture Partners, Insight Partners, Two Sigma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Columbia University, New York University, Fordham University, CUNY, AI Now Institute, Flatiron Institute, C.N. Yang Institute for Theoretical Physics, NASA Space Radiation Laboratory
